While exploring Hong Kong and Macau, make sure to visit some hidden gems and local favorites. In Hong Kong, visit the quirky neighborhood of Tai Hang, known for its vibrant street art and trendy dining scene. In Macau, explore the Coloane Village, a charming area with Portuguese colonial architecture and delicious local food.
